STARTING POINTS.

Together with Geonius we have formulated the following principles:

Increasing security in the centre of Hasselt, especially on the Kolonel Dusartplein.
Remote-controlled lighting by means of an application.
A product that is so compact that it fits into the mast and/or the central unit.
Specific parties such as the municipality and the police must have access to control luminaires in the event of calamities.
The data flows must be secure.

OUR APPROACH.

Fosfari has collaborated with Remoticom many times in the past. For this specific case, we highlight the Kolonel Dusartplein in Hasselt and our products: the Dali 4 controller, the Emergency app and the ZSC100.

This time, Fosfari came to us with the question whether we could think along about the safety of the square by means of lighting. There are many cafés on the square and in the evening it can sometimes get too cosy, causing trouble.

By default, the lighting in the square is on a fixed light setting (in this case 20%). But in case of calamities, it should be possible to scale up to 100%. By using the Emergency app, through the NB-IoT network, this can be realised. In this way the municipality, in cooperation with the police, can guarantee public safety at the square.

In addition, there was a specific request for an efficient solution that did not require the company to travel to individual control cabinets every time. More flexible working and less CO2 emissions were desired.

Solution.

Based on the briefing, we were able to recommend our Dali 1.04 controllers, which were installed in the relevant masts in the square. With limited access to the luminaires through the use of the Emergency app, another step towards a lasting relationship and the safety of cities has been taken.

! By the way, this is the first time the Emergency app has been rolled out in combination with our Dali 1.04 controller.

A piece of intelligence has also been added to various luminaires in the city of Hasselt, where our Zhaga Smart Controllers (ZSC100) have been used, which have been fitted to the relevant luminaires in a plug & play manner.
